Landscape

Mittlerer Höhenberg and Vorderer Höhenberg are located in the immediate vicinity of Kleinschmalkalden.

The village lies in a deeply incised valley of the Schmalkalde and its side valleys; the surrounding wooded heights range approximately from 600 to 800 meters.

A giant cowbell is also listed in Kleinschmalkalden and is described as the “largest cowbell in the world.”

Getting There

Kleinschmalkalden can be reached from Schmalkalden by bus on MBB route 445.

Kleinschmalkalden lies in the Schmalkalde Valley on the southwestern slope of the Thuringian Forest.

The Rennsteig is approximately five kilometers from Kleinschmalkalden.

Kleinschmalkalden has two Protestant churches, reflecting the historic division of the settlement between Saxony/Gotha and Hesse.
